16 | 45 | An Act relating to school libraries; directing | |
17 | 46 | library media program to be reflective of community | |
18 | 47 | standards when acquiring materials , resources, and | |
19 | 48 | equipment; providing for codification; and providing | |
20 | 49 | an effective date. | |
21 | 50 | ||
22 | 51 | ||
23 | 52 | ||
24 | 53 | ||
25 | - | SUBJECT: School libraries | |
26 | 54 | ||
27 | 55 | BE IT ENACTED BY TH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F OKLAHOMA: | |
28 | - | ||
29 | 56 | SECTION 1. NEW LAW A new section of law to b e codified | |
30 | 57 | in the Oklahoma Statutes as Section 11-201 of Title 70, unless there | |
31 | 58 | is created a duplication in numbering, reads as follows: | |
32 | - | ||
33 | 59 | As school library media center resources are finite, the library | |
34 | 60 | media program shall be reflective of the community sta ndards for the | |
35 | 61 | population the library media center serves when acquiring an age- | |
36 | 62 | appropriate collection of print materials, non print materials, | |
37 | 63 | multimedia resources, equipment, and supplies adequate in quality | |
38 | 64 | and quantity to meet the needs of students in a ll areas of the | |
39 | 65 | school library media program. | |
